Position Description:
Located on the campus of Fort Hays State University, the Beach/Schmidt Performing Arts Center (PAC) is an 1100 seat roadhouse venue that opened in 1991 after a complete renovation. The PAC serves the campus and community as a beautiful performance space for music recitals, concerts, touring shows, dance recitals, and more. 
 
The Production Support Technical Coordinator is responsible for operating and maintaining the facility’s technical systems and leading a staff of student employees to assist in performing those tasks. This includes proficiency in all technical aspects (lighting, audio, video, fly system, etc.), and assistance in the upkeep and maintenance of the facility’s equipment. The Production Support Technical Coordinator will be responsible to learn and utilize these systems to execute daily activities for a wide range of events. They will be responsible to train and lead a team of student employees to achieve the desired goals of guest satisfaction, seamless equipment operation, and quality upkeep of the facility.

Preferred Qualifications
·         3 or more years of technical theatre experience. 
·         Experience with technical theatre production process and/or front of house operations. 
·         Eager to learn new technology and skills in live events. 
·         Strong communication skills with the ability to explain technical procedures verbally or in writing. 
·         Strong technical troubleshooting skills. 
·         Experience with basic structured wiring tasks such terminating, soldering, documenting, etc. 
·         Knowledge and experience with audio mixing, microphone techniques, proper sound system deployment/configuration/tuning, analog audio routing, and digital audio networking (Dante, AES), Yamaha and Behringer audio consoles. 
·         Knowledge and experience with theatrical lighting practices, conventional lighting fixtures, LED lighting fixtures, moving head light fixtures, proper focus, and programming techniques on ETC EOS and Elation Onyx consoles. 
·         Projection and projection control software experience including QLab and Pro Presenter.

Responsibilities: 
·         Oversight of all theater technical needs. 
·         Advance all incoming events for technical needs in coordination with the Production Systems Manager. 
·         Coordinate show needs with Production Systems Manager. 
·         Hire, train and supervise a support team of six student employees. Provide extensive and on-going training, schedule student staff to fill technical roles during all events in the venue. 
·         Responsible for care and maintenance of facility’s equipment. 
·         Arrange for or hire necessary labor employees contractually required for touring shows. 
·         Manages time sheets for all support team student employees, and any students or temporary staff members hired to work for the Encore series shows. 
·         Working closely with touring crews to facilitate their needs. 
·         For touring events, provides on-site supervision of road crews and student stage crews, directs technical elements for events including but not limited to staging, lighting, sound, labor, safety, rigging, and house management. 
·         Setup and operate audio, lighting, and video systems as needed for scheduled events. 
·         Live stream events when requested. 
·         Records live performances as requested by artists or colleagues. 
·         Repair and maintain theater technical equipment. 
·         Maintains stage, scene shop and storage areas in clean and orderly condition. 
·         Recommends and implements upgrades to existing audio, video, lighting systems and equipment inventory. 
·         Promote safe practices in all areas of theatre operations. 
·         Ability to work irregular hours, including nights and weekends as needed. 
·         Excellent customer service skills dealing with university faculty and staff, public, and other production staff. 
·         Ability to lift and carry up to 50-75 lbs at one time. 
·         Willing to work on catwalks, platform lifts, at heights, and on ladders. 
·         Effectively collaborate with team members at all levels with a positive and willing attitude. 
·         Basic skills on Windows and Mac computers.  Working knowledge of networking technologies. 
·         Safely operate a mixed single/double purchase manual counterweight rigging system. 
·         Flexibility to deal with last minute changes in a fluid work environment.
